I have configure my 12.04 system to use pam_cracklib to enforce
password compexity requirements. I have put this line in /etc/pam.d
/common-password at the top:
password requisite pam_cracklib.so
retry=3 dcredit=-1 difok=4 lcredit=-1 minlen=14 ocredit=-1 ucredit=-1
At the command line if a user changes their password and doesn't meet
the complexity requirements it tells them so and re-asks for a
password. At the lightdm login screen if a user's password has
expired it tells them so and asks for a new password. If the
complexity requirements are not meant it tells them in red letters but
just asks them to reenter the bad password. /etc/pam.d/lightdm
includes common-password at the bottom so I thought this woud be
sufficient bu it appears not.
